Digital Evidence From The Scene
One of the first ways technology can assist is in gathering evidence at the accident scene. Smartphones are invaluable for capturing photos and videos that show property damage, injuries, road conditions, and environmental factors. These details can paint a vivid picture of what occurred, and their timestamps provide a clear record of events. Similarly, if there are nearby security cameras, footage can often be requested to corroborate your account of the incident.
In car accident cases, dashcams have become increasingly common and are a powerful source of evidence. The footage can capture the exact moment of impact, vehicle movements, and even road conditions leading up to the accident. This objective documentation helps establish the facts in ways that verbal testimony cannot always achieve.
Leveraging Wearable Devices
Our Lakeland personal injury lawyer knows that wearable technology, such as fitness trackers or smartwatches, has gained traction in personal injury cases. These devices record data about physical activity, heart rate, and sleep patterns. If your injury affects your ability to move or maintain a regular routine, the changes shown in this data can highlight how the incident has disrupted your life. For instance, a sharp drop in daily activity levels or disrupted sleep patterns can underscore the injury’s ongoing impact.
Additionally, wearable technology can be used to refute opposing claims. If there is any dispute about the extent of your injuries, these devices provide objective proof of how your life has changed.
Accident Reconstruction Tools
Recreating how an accident happened can be a pivotal part of proving fault. Advanced software allows for the creation of 3D simulations based on data collected from the scene. These simulations are not only compelling but also clarify the sequence of events for jurors or insurance adjusters who may not fully grasp the details of your case.
Accident reconstruction tools analyze variables such as vehicle speed, angles of collision, and the impact’s force. By combining scientific data with visual aids, this approach strengthens your claim and leaves little room for doubt.
Documenting Recovery And Medical Treatment
Tracking your recovery process is just as important as documenting the injury itself. Technology can play a key role here, too. Mobile apps allow for detailed journaling of symptoms, appointments, and medications. Photographs and videos taken over time can also demonstrate how injuries have healed or worsened. This documentation creates a timeline that links your injuries directly to the incident.

Most Common Types Of Personal Injury Lawsuits
Personal injury cases arise when an individual is harmed due to another party’s negligence, recklessness, or intentional actions. These cases can involve various accidents and injuries, each requiring different legal considerations. Motor Vehicle Accidents
Motor vehicle accidents are among the most frequent causes of personal injury cases. These accidents involve cars, trucks, motorcycles, bicycles, or pedestrians. The primary cause of these accidents is often driver negligence or recklessness, such as speeding, distracted driving (texting or using a phone), driving under the influence of alcohol or drugs, or failing to obey traffic laws.
- Common Injuries: Motor vehicle accidents can result in a range of injuries, from mild to severe, including whiplash, broken bones, spinal cord injuries, traumatic brain injuries, and even death in extreme cases.
- Legal Considerations: The injured party typically sues the at-fault driver or their insurance company for compensation in these cases. If another party’s negligence caused the accident, the injured person may be entitled to compensation for medical bills, lost wages, pain and suffering, and emotional distress.
Slip And Fall Accidents
Slip and fall accidents, also known as premises liability cases, occur when a person falls due to hazardous conditions on someone else’s property. Property owners or businesses are legally responsible for maintaining safe environments for visitors. Failing to address hazards such as wet floors, uneven surfaces, poor lighting, or obstacles in walkways can lead to serious injuries. - Common Injuries: Common injuries in slip and fall accidents include sprains, fractures, head injuries, and broken bones. In some cases, falls can lead to long-term disabilities, especially for elderly individuals.
- Legal Considerations: In slip and fall cases, the injured person must prove that the property owner was negligent in maintaining a safe environment. This includes showing that the hazard was present for a sufficient amount of time for the owner to notice and address it, or that the owner failed to warn visitors about the danger. Compensation may cover medical expenses, lost wages, and pain and suffering.
Medical Malpractice
Medical malpractice occurs when a healthcare professional or facility fails to provide the standard level of care, harming a patient. This can happen due to errors in diagnosis, treatment, surgery, or medication, often leading to severe consequences for the patient.
- Common Injuries: Injuries from medical malpractice can include misdiagnoses, surgical mistakes, medication errors, childbirth injuries, or anesthesia mistakes. The consequences can be life-threatening, permanently disabling, or fatal.
- Legal Considerations: Medical malpractice claims require proving that the healthcare provider’s actions fell below the accepted standard of care in the medical community and that this failure directly caused the injury. Expert testimony from medical professionals is often needed to establish negligence and demonstrate the extent of the harm caused.
Product Liability
Product liability cases arise when an individual is injured by a defective or dangerous product. Manufacturers, distributors, and retailers can be held accountable if their products are defectively designed or manufactured or lack proper warnings about potential risks.
- Common Injuries: Injuries from defective products can include burns, lacerations, broken bones, poisoning, or even death, depending on the nature of the defect. Common defective products include automobiles, appliances, medical devices, toys, and pharmaceuticals.
- Legal Considerations: Product liability claims can be based on defects in design, manufacturing, or marketing (failure to warn of potential dangers). The injured party must prove that the product was defectively designed or manufactured and that the defect caused the injury. If many consumers are affected by the same defect, these cases often involve class action lawsuits.
